  9. Blackwell George Wilmott

    Blackwell George Wilmott

    Midshipman on board H.M.S. Caledonia he died at Malta 19th May 1850 aged 17, and was the 2nd son of George Graham Blackwell, Esqr, of Ampney Park, Gloucestershire. This memorial is located in the Holy Rood the parish church of Ampney Crucis

  18. Woodward Walter

    Woodward Walter

    Walter Woodward late Regimental Quartermaster Sergeant died 30th September 1904 aged 39. Buried at Stratton Cemetery, near Cirencester, Gloucestershire. his son Sergeant 8925 Walter John, C Coy, 1st Gloucestershire Regiment was killed in action at Givenchy France on the 25th January 1915 aged 23...
